問題タブ [tfs-2015]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
4599 参照

powershell - Powershell から vNext ビルドを開始し、アーティファクトを取得する

デプロイを自動化するために、特定の ChangeSetId に基づいてアプリケーションを再構築したいと考えています。このビルドが完了したら、ビルドのアーティファクト(.exe) を取得してデプロイできるようにします。質問のために、「ビルドからアーティファクトを取得する」部分に焦点を当てています。

DevOps の目的で、TFS API ライブラリにアクセスできる必要があり、MS が PowerShell の使用を推奨しているため、PowerShell を使用したいと思います。

環境

オンプレミス TFS 2015 サーバーでビルドをセットアップしました (これは正常に動作しています) 。このビルドの後にVSO タスク「アーティファクトの公開」を追加しました。ここまでは順調ですね。公開されたアーティファクトはサーバーに保存されます。これは基本的に、ビルドに接続されたアーティファクトをダウンロードする必要があることを意味します-既存のすべてのビルドにはアーティファクトがリンクされます-これは私の本のUNCドロップよりも優れています.

いいえ、私の挑戦はありません。これらのアーティファクトにプログラムでアクセスするにはどうすればよいですか (ステップ 3)。

  1. ChangeSetId のソースを取得する
  2. 指定された構成の MSBuild アプリケーション
  3. PowerShell を使用してビルド アーティファクトを取得する
  4. Release Management (Powershell も) を使用して環境にデプロイする
0 投票する
2 に答える
6365 参照

visual-studio-2013 - VS 2013 Update 5 から TFS 2015 でプロジェクトを作成できない

Update 5TFS 2015から新しいプロジェクトを作成しようとすると、次のエラーが表示されます。VS 2013

TF400324: サーバーから Team Foundation サービスを利用できません。

技術情報 (管理者向け): TF200038: お使いのバージョンのチーム エクスプローラーではチーム プロジェクトを作成できません

0 投票する
1 に答える
330 参照

tfs - TFS レポート、FactBuildProject および FactBuildDetails が空

TFS 2015 オンプレミスを使用しており、標準の SCRUM テンプレートを使用しています。1 つのチーム プロジェクトがあり、チーム フィールドを使用して作業を分離しています。ここ数週間で、いくつかのビルド定義を作成し、いくつかのビルドを実行しました。

TFS をインストールしたとき、後で行う予定だったので、すぐに Reporting Services をインストールまたは構成しませんでした。私はこれを行って以来、FactBuildProjectまたはFactBuildDetailsではなく、ほとんどのもので更新されているTfs_Warehouseを持っています。FactCurrentWorkItem や FactBuildCoverage など、私の他のファクトのいくつかは引き継がれています。TFS 管理コンソールでウェアハウスを再構築しました。

これは標準プロセス テンプレートおよび標準レポートであるため、必須フィールドはレポート可能に設定する必要があります。

FactBuildProject テーブルのデータを取得するにはどうすればよいですか? また、どこで問題を探すことができますか? どこから始めればいいのかわからないし、世界中で同じような問題を抱えている人を見つけることができない.

0 投票する
2 に答える
214 参照

.net - Visual Studio 2015 および TFS 2015 でデフォルトの認識されないコード分析単語グローバルをオーバーライドする方法は?

次のコード分析エラーがあります。

ここに画像の説明を入力

それは言う:

CA1704 メンバー名 'Default.ImgLogo' の 'Img' のスペルを修正するか、ハンガリー語表記を表している場合は完全に削除してください。

コード分​​析辞書にこれがあります:

これによると辞書のグローバルな認識されないリストにあるためです\Program Files (x86)\Microsoft Visual Studio 10.0\Team Tools\Static Analysis Tools\FxCop

各開発者 PC とビルド エージェントでこれを手動で行う必要はありますか?
もちろん、Imgを使用しないことを超えて。

これは、Visual Studio 2015、TFS 2015 にあります。

0 投票する
1 に答える
2774 参照

tfs - tfs 2015 "vNext" ビルドでゲート チェックインを構成するにはどうすればよいですか?

新しいビルドシステムは非常にエキサイティングです。しかし...

XAML ビルド定義で利用できるように、TFS バージョン コントロールを使用してゲート チェックインでビルド定義を作成する方法があるかどうか知りたいですか?

それは隠されたオプションですか、それとも見つけにくいですか? そうでない場合、それを行うための拡張機能を開発することは可能ですか、それとも MS がサポートするのを待つ必要がありますか?

0 投票する
1 に答える
697 参照

build - TFS 2015 のビルド プロセス テンプレートはありますか?

通常、Team Foundation Server のすべての新しいメジャー バージョンには、既定の XAML ビルド プロセス テンプレートの新しいバージョンが付属しています。

TFS 2015 で導入された新しいビルド vNext システムについてはよく知っていますが、従来のシステムに関しては、新しいビルド プロセス テンプレートはありますか?

0 投票する
2 に答える
506 参照

tfs-2015 - ビルド タスクのアップロード時の TFS 2015 例外

tfx-cliツールを使用して新しい TFS ビルド システムにタスクをアップロードしようとすると、TFS ログに次のエラーが表示されます。

残念ながら、これは TFS がダウンロード用に提供するエージェントです。オンプレミスの TFS サーバーです。

エージェントの 1.88 バージョンを入手する方法を知っている人はいますか?